Continue to Site

Welcome to EDAboard.com

Welcome to our site! EDAboard.com is an international Electronics Discussion Forum focused on EDA software, circuits, schematics, books, theory, papers, asic, pld, 8051, DSP, Network, RF, Analog Design, PCB, Service Manuals... and a whole lot more! To participate you need to register. Registration is free. Click here to register now.

synthesis capture clock

Status
Not open for further replies.

raj1435

Newbie level 5
Joined
Mar 19, 2015
Messages
10
Helped
1
Reputation
2
Reaction score
1
Trophy points
3
Activity points
60
Hi,

Can any one explain me about capture clock time period in the synthesis timing report. To make it more clear i have the time period of the 10ns,
in the timing report i am seeing the capture clock time period is the half the total time period i.e 5ns.

can any one explain clearly why it was.

Thanks
 

It will be always half cycle path in the synthesis or full cycle. can you explain me why it will be a half cycle path.
 

If ur clock is 10 ns and if the launch is at 0ns then the capture will be at 10 ns. If you are seeing capture at 5 ns, then it must be capturing data on the negedge of clock. Otherwise you must have constrained it accordingly. Go back to the RTL and check this particular timing path.
 
Hi,

can you explain me ,what are the conditions that incorporate a half cycle time period in the RTL. from synthesis constrained point of view i havn't constrained as half cycle.
 

Hi,

can you explain me ,what are the conditions that incorporate a half cycle time period in the RTL. from synthesis constrained point of view i havn't constrained as half cycle.

hi Raj1435,
it's not from what you "constraint" the path (in your design). it come from what you designed
- your launch flop L : normal, CK feed clock pin of your flop
- your capture flop C : the CK signal is inverted to original.
--> you launch data from L at rising edge of clock pin L, and then capture data at C - rising edge of clock pin C . but now, rising edge of clock pin C is from falling edge of clock pin L because of inverter in clock path between L and C. so, you have Launch at rising and Capture at falling.
that just a case, maybe you also used a paid pos-neg flops.
so, please check your logic design to see (your netlist)
 
Hi
Thanks for the reply i understand the issues. i wanted to know what is mean by paid pos-neg flops.
 

Status
Not open for further replies.

Part and Inventory Search

Welcome to EDABoard.com

Sponsor

Back
Top